I went through so many different stages of stylizing the characters but I'm very happy with how I draw them now. Older concepts in the collage. I just thought the old ones were a little bland and boring especially while drawing them. They didnt look "fun" so i decided to just focus on shapes rather than try to follow a reference. 
G-man one was a request c:  

I like Gordon being squares and rectangles. Tall and lanky but still with enough big shapes to give some strength. I did start with giving Gordon's suit normal sized arms but thought it looked a bit boring so BIG SUIT ARMS HELL YA 
Barney tho I just think I want him to have shorter sharper shapes so traingles are really nice and makes understanding drawing his helmet way easier for me while emphasizing other features like cheekbones and jaw and I like the way it makes him look more abstract

The contrast between the shapes makes for a goofy yet nice dynamic when drawing them together c:
